Former Arsenal striker Jeremie Aliadiere has urged the club to target Chelsea winger Pedro Neto in a surprise £70m deal after missing out on Vinicius Junior. Neto has scored 19 goals in 103 appearances since joining Chelsea in 2024. Manchester City also want him. Chelsea's 41-player squad means departures are necessary, manager Xabi Alonso acknowledged, to achieve proper balance. Aliadiere cited Arsenal's heavy recent spending and need to balance books, noting they already signed left winger Christos Tzolis for £40m. He said Neto is established and knows the Premier League.
